New York Court of Appeals

The People of the State of New York, Respondent v. Dushon Foster, Also Known as Ivien Jones, Appellant

June 13, 199585 N.Y.2d 1012

Summary

The New York Court of Appeals affirmed the Appellate Division's order, holding that the officer had reasonable suspicion to detain the defendant and that handcuffing was justified to protect safety, thus denying the motion to suppress.
